Worst Year of My Life, Again is an engaging Australian television series that aired on the ABC3 channel in the year 2014. The sitcom-style drama revolves around the life of its lead character, Alex King, attractively portrayed by Ned Napier. The show captures Alex's intricate encounters and timeless adventures after he wakes up one day to unexpectedly find that he is reliving his 14th year of existence - one he recalls as the "worst year of his life." The series aptly merges the complexities of teenage life with mysterious elements of time travel, providing an entertaining watch for viewers interested in both genres.

The story unravels as Alex King gets traumatically catapulted back into the past, the very day before his 15th birthday, forced to re-experience this turbulent year of his life. In this unexpected second attempt at his past, Alex is confronted with the same embarrassing incidents, catastrophic birthday parties, disastrous love affairs, detention punishments, and many other teen misadventures that originally marked his "worst year." Although Alex retains the memory of his past experiences, everyone around him, from his friends to his family, behaves as if it's their first time living through these events. Alongside Napier, "Worst Year of My Life, Again" boasts a vibrant cast of characters that help bring this peculiar storyline to life. These encompass Alex’s best friends, Simon Birch and Maddy Kent, portrayed by Laurence Boxhall and Lana Golja respectively, who remain oblivious to Alex's perennial debacle.
